How to use Dsef 6mg Tablet:
Follow your doctor's instructions precisely regarding dosage and treatment length for this medication. Ingest the tablet whole; do not break, crush, or chew it. The 6mg Dsef tablet can be administered with or without food, but consistency in timing is recommended. Avoid consuming this medication with meals primarily consisting of salads and vegetables.
How Dsef 6mg Tablet works:
Glucocorticoid levels are elevated by the corticosteroid medication Dsef 6mg Tablet. Its mechanism involves reducing inflammation-inducing substances and dampening immune responses, thus preventing the body's immune system from attacking itself (as seen in autoimmune disorders, organ transplantation, and cancer).
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holUNSAFE
Combining Dsef 6mg Tablet and alcohol is unsafe.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
The use of Dsef 6mg Tablet during pregnancy may pose risks. While human research is scant, animal studies indicate potential harm to a developing fetus. A physician will assess the potential advantages against any possible risks prior to prescribing. Seek medical advice.
Breast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Administration of Dsef 6mg tablets while breastfeeding is likely inadvisable. Available human data indicates potential transfer to breast milk, posing a possible risk to the infant.
DrivingSAFE
Driving ability is typically unaffected by Dsef 6mg Tablet.
KidneySA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Patients with kidney impairment can safely take Dsef 6mg tablets without requiring any alteration to the prescribed dosage.
LiverS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Patients with liver impairment can safely take Dsef 6mg tablets without requiring any alteration to the prescribed dosage.
What if you forget to take Dsef 6mg Tablet :
Should you forget a Dsef 6mg Tablet dose, take it immediately. Nevertheless, if your next d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
